Parkers

The Renault Koleos (2017-2020) receives praise for its spacious interior, comfortable ride and extensive equipment. However, its performance is sometimes regarded as underwhelming, especially compared to rivals. The infotainment system can also feel outdated, while the overall styling may not appeal to everyone.

Autocar

AutoCar highlights the Koleos's robust build quality and generous interior space. Its stylish design is appreciated, though handling isn’t as sharp as some competitors. The engine range offers reasonable efficiency, but refinement could be improved, particularly at higher speeds.

WhatCar

WhatCar notes that the Koleos boasts a comfortable and spacious cabin, making it a solid family vehicle. Criticisms include its lack of engaging driving dynamics and somewhat average engine performance. Nevertheless, safety ratings and equipment levels are commendable.

Specs by trim

Dynamique S Nav dCi 130 5dDiesel Manual · 2017–2019
Power
128 bhp
0–60 mph
11 s
Top speed
115 mph
Torque
320 Nm
Economy
57 mpg
Range
752 mi
CO₂
128 g/km
Insurance group
18
Road tax
£190
New price
£27,840
